The Unique Engineering of a Pedestal Base

Before comparing materials, it is helpful to understand why the material choice is so critical for this specific type of chair. A pedestal base chair relies on a single central column connected to a wide foot or "star" base. This design requires the material to possess high tensile strength and rigidity.


If the material is too flexible, the chair will feel unstable. If it is too brittle, it might snap under sudden pressure. The base acts as the counterweight, keeping the center of gravity low to prevent tipping. Therefore, light, flimsy materials often fail in this application unless they are engineered with specific reinforcements.


Top Materials for Chair Bases

Here is a breakdown of the most popular materials found in the market today, along with their specific characteristics.


Aluminum

Aluminum is increasingly becoming the gold standard for high-quality pedestal base chair designs. It offers an exceptional balance of strength-to-weight ratio. It is light enough to move around easily but strong enough to support significant weight without bending.


One of the biggest advantages of aluminum is its resistance to corrosion. Unlike steel, aluminum naturally forms a protective oxide layer, making it immune to rust. This makes it an excellent choice for varied environments, including coastal areas or humid climates.


Aesthetically, aluminum is versatile. It can be polished to a mirror-like chrome finish, brushed for a matte look, or powder-coated in various colors. Manufacturers like Zhunxing often utilize aluminum for its ability to look premium while offering industrial-grade durability.


Stainless Steel

Steel is the heavyweight champion of chair bases. It is incredibly strong and provides a solid, heavy anchor for furniture. This weight is a significant benefit for pedestal tables or large lounge chairs where tipping is a concern.


However, steel has drawbacks. It is susceptible to rust if the surface coating is scratched or chipped. It is also very heavy, which can make moving furniture difficult. From a design perspective, steel often has a more industrial look, which may or may not suit your interior design goals.


Wood

Wood offers a warmth and classic appeal that metal simply cannot replicate. A wooden pedestal base is often found in dining rooms or traditional office settings. Hardwoods like oak, walnut, or maple are durable and sturdy.


The downside to wood is maintenance. It is sensitive to humidity and temperature changes, which can cause it to crack or warp over time. Additionally, wood joints can loosen, requiring occasional tightening or repair. While beautiful, it often lacks the sheer mechanical endurance of metal alternatives in high-traffic commercial settings.


Nylon and Plastic

For budget-friendly office chairs, nylon or high-grade plastic is a common choice. These materials are lightweight, inexpensive, and resistant to rust. High-quality reinforced nylon can be surprisingly tough and is often used in standard task chairs.


However, plastic lacks the premium feel of metal or wood. Over time, plastic can degrade from UV exposure or become brittle, leading to cracks. It generally has a lower weight capacity compared to aluminum or steel and is less suitable for heavy-duty applications.

Why Aluminum Often Wins the Debate

When weighing the pros and cons, aluminum frequently emerges as the best all-around material for a pedestal base chair.


Its specific blend of properties solves many common issues. For example, in a dental clinic or a salon, hygiene and cleanliness are paramount. An aluminum base is easy to wipe down and won't rust from frequent cleaning. In an office setting, employees need to scoot their chairs in and out frequently; the lightweight nature of aluminum makes this effortless compared to heavy steel.


Furthermore, aluminum casting technology allows for intricate and ergonomic shapes. Manufacturers can create star bases (like three-star, four-star, or five-star variations) that are both structurally sound and visually appealing. This flexibility allows designers to create furniture that looks as good as it performs.


Factors to Consider for Your Environment

While aluminum is a strong contender, the "best" material ultimately depends on where the chair will live.


High-Traffic Commercial Spaces

If you are buying for a waiting room, school, or hotel, durability is your top priority. You need a material that can withstand constant use and abuse. Metal bases—specifically aluminum or steel—are superior here. They resist scuffs and impacts better than wood or plastic.


Home Offices and Dining

In residential spaces, aesthetics might take precedence. A wooden base might be perfect for a mid-century modern dining table where traffic is low. However, for a home office chair that you sit in for eight hours a day, an aluminum star base offers better long-term reliability and ergonomic support.


Outdoor Settings

If the chair is for a patio or balcony, you must consider the elements. Wood (unless teak) will rot, and steel will rust. Aluminum or high-quality UV-resistant plastics are the only viable options for outdoor longevity.
